Lift Every Voice
Group Exhibit
A Tribute to Elizabeth Catlett by 14 Regional Rug Hookers
This exhibition honors the enduring legacy of Harlem Renaissance artist Elizabeth Catlett. Inspired by her powerful 1947 block print series I Am the Black Woman, these hand-hooked rugs reimagine Catlett’s work in fiber, offering a contemporary reflection on her themes of resilience, labor, and dignity.
The rug hookers in this exhibition honor Catlett’s vision, translating her bold, graphic prints into fiber while preserving their emotional depth and historical significance. Through intricate loops and textures, these works celebrate Catlett’s lifelong mission: making art that belongs to everyone and speaks to the liberation of the heart, spirit, and mind. By reinterpreting these images through fiber, the artists extend Catlett’s legacy, ensuring that her message of justice and perseverance continues to inspire new generations.
